Del. HC: Accrual of Cause of Action at a Place is not a Consideration for Determining Jurisdiction - (29 Sep 2023)

ARBITRATION

Delhi High Court has held that accrual of cause of action at a place for pursuing a substantive legal action is not a consideration for determining jurisdiction for the purposes of Section 11 of A&C Act, 1996, location of seat of arbitration is what will be a relevant consideration.
